Hello-
My E39 2001 celis Hella tail lights are acting up... just tonight I noticed the turn signals work fine, brake lighs are fine, reverse lights are fine..but the LED running lights are not coming on..they wont turn on in any switch position, parking light position...can't figure this out. I checked all fuses, wiring harness...don't see anything wrong. Please let me know what ideas you all have....I have never seen this or found any good posts on this.

So I took my taillight off and there was water on the passenger side taillight, I have shaken and dried it completely...but when i put the plug back in..no LED lights..only the turn signal, brake lights and reverse light work..both sides have LEDs not working. Could the water have shorted out a relay? Anyone know where to look from here...im out of ideas and need taillights at night!
Thanks
 
#6 · (Edited)
sounds like the transistor(s) in the lcm might have gotten fried; there are no relays. if you can get your hands on a voltmeter i would test the voltage across the pins, to see if there is still power coming to the lights. iirc the pin #6 is the power to the celis bars/leds and pin #3 should be ground on the right side. and on the left side its pins 1 and 4 respectively..
